    ESCO has introduced a new, aggressively designed bucket to help excavator users trench in the most difficult ground conditions. The VDXP V-bottom excavator bucket is intended for difficult pipeline and trenching work where reliability and performance is important. Modeled after ESCO's extreme heavy-duty XDP plate lip bucket which performs capably in demanding applications, the VDXP is available for 25- to 30-ton hydraulic excavators.

    The PosiGrab II hydraulic coupler from Weir ESCO is an update from the company's established PosiGrab unit that features new security measures to protect against hydraulic system failure, as well as improvements to weight and height. Debuted at CONEXPO-CON/AGG 2023, the PosiGrab II is a multi-pin design that enables engagement with a range of buckets and attachments within a given tonnage class and can be fully operated, including locked confirmation, from the cab of the machine.
